Where are the Operands?
Special place
Where are the Operands?
Real place
Symbolic place called pool
JVM keeps this fake references
It’s a strategy to deal with dynamic linking
While JVM does not need the content of this fake box (pool), it remais
unresolved
Each fake reference for each method is unique
Each fake reference for each method is uniqueSo JVM can replace the
fake calls with true invokes.
